Bitcoin Total Output Volume

4 stars based on 43 reviews

The bitcoin network is a peer-to-peer payment network that operates on a cryptographic protocol. It is widely associated with money launderingblack marketsfraud and other criminal activities. Users send and receive bitcoinsthe units of currency, by broadcasting digitally signed messages to the network using bitcoin cryptocurrency wallet software.

Transactions are recorded into a distributed, replicated public database known as the blockchainwith consensus achieved by a proof-of-work system called mining.

Satoshi Nakamotothe designer of bitcoin claimed that design and coding of bitcoin began in The network requires minimal structure to share transactions. An ad hoc decentralized network of volunteers is sufficient. Messages are broadcast on a best effort basis, and nodes can leave and rejoin the network at will.

Upon reconnection, a node downloads and verifies new blocks from other nodes to complete its local copy of the blockchain. A bitcoin is defined by a sequence of digitally signed transactions that began with the bitcoin's creation, as a block reward. The owner of a bitcoin transfers it by digitally signing it over to the next owner using a bitcoin transaction, much like endorsing a traditional bank check.

A payee can examine each previous transaction to verify the chain of ownership. Unlike traditional check endorsements, bitcoin transactions bitcoin output volume irreversible, which eliminates risk of chargeback fraud.

Although it is possible to handle bitcoins individually, it would be unwieldy to require a separate transaction for every bitcoin in a transaction. Transactions are therefore allowed to contain multiple inputs and outputs, allowing bitcoins to be split and combined. Common transactions will have either a single input from a larger previous transaction or multiple inputs combining smaller amounts, and one or two outputs: Any difference between the total input and output amounts bitcoin output volume a transaction goes to miners as a transaction fee.

To form a distributed timestamp server as a peer-to-peer network, bitcoin uses a proof-of-work system. The signature is discovered rather than provided by knowledge. This process is energy bitcoin output volume. Requiring a proof of work to accept a new block to the blockchain was Satoshi Nakamoto 's key innovation.

The mining process involves identifying a block that, when hashed twice with SHAyields a number smaller than bitcoin output volume given difficulty target. While the average work required increases in inverse proportion to the difficulty target, a hash can always be verified by executing a single round of double SHA For bitcoin output volume bitcoin timestamp bitcoin output volume, a valid proof of work is found by incrementing a nonce until a value is found that gives the block's hash the required number of leading zero bits.

Once the hashing bitcoin output volume produced a valid result, the block cannot bitcoin output volume changed without redoing the work. As later blocks are chained after it, the work to change the block would include redoing the work for each subsequent block.

Majority consensus in bitcoin is represented by the longest chain, which required the greatest amount of effort to produce. If a majority of computing power is controlled bitcoin output volume honest nodes, the honest chain will grow fastest and outpace any competing chains. To modify a past block, an attacker would have to redo the proof-of-work of that block and all blocks after it and then surpass the work of the honest nodes.

The probability of a slower attacker catching up diminishes exponentially as subsequent blocks are added. To compensate for increasing hardware speed and varying interest in running nodes over time, the difficulty of finding a valid hash is adjusted roughly every two weeks.

If blocks are generated too quickly, the difficulty increases and more hashes are required to make a block and to generate new bitcoins.

Bitcoin mining is a competitive endeavor. An " arms race " has been observed through the various hashing technologies that have been used to mine bitcoins: As bitcoins have become more difficult to mine, computer hardware manufacturing companies have seen an increase in sales of high-end ASIC products. Computing power is often bundled together or "pooled" to reduce variance in miner income.

Individual mining rigs often bitcoin output volume to wait for long periods to confirm a block of transactions and receive payment. In a pool, all bitcoin output volume miners get paid every time a participating server solves a block. This payment depends on the amount of work an individual miner contributed to help find that block. Bitcoin data centers prefer to keep a low profile, bitcoin output volume dispersed around the world and tend to cluster around the availability of cheap electricity.

InMark Gimein estimated electricity consumption to be about As ofThe Economist estimated that bitcoin output volume if all miners used modern facilities, the combined electricity consumption would be To lower the costs, bitcoin miners have set up in places like Iceland where geothermal energy is bitcoin output volume and cooling Arctic air is free. A rough overview of the process to mine bitcoins is: By convention, the first transaction in a block is a special transaction that bitcoin output volume new bitcoins owned by the creator of the block.

This is the incentive for nodes to support the network. The reward for mining halves everyblocks. It started at 50 bitcoin, dropped to 25 bitcoin output volume late bitcoin output volume to This halving process is programmed to continue for 64 times before new coin creation ceases.

Various potential attacks on the bitcoin network and its use as a bitcoin output volume system, real or theoretical, have been considered. The bitcoin protocol includes several features that protect it against some of those attacks, such as unauthorized spending, double spending, forging bitcoins, and bitcoin output volume with the blockchain.

Other attacks, such as theft of private keys, require due care by bitcoin output volume. Unauthorized spending is mitigated by bitcoin's implementation of public-private key cryptography. For example; when Alice sends a bitcoin to Bob, Bob becomes the new owner of the bitcoin.

Eve observing the transaction might want to spend the bitcoin Bob just received, but she cannot sign the transaction without the knowledge of Bob's private key. A specific problem that an internet payment system must solve is double-spendingwhereby a user pays the same coin to two or more different recipients. An example of such a problem would be if Eve sent a bitcoin to Alice and later sent the same bitcoin to Bob.

The bitcoin network guards against double-spending by recording bitcoin output volume bitcoin transfers in a ledger the blockchain that is visible to all users, and ensuring for all transferred bitcoins that they haven't been previously spent.

If Eve offers to pay Alice a bitcoin in exchange for goods and signs a corresponding transaction, it is still possible that she also creates a different transaction at the same time sending the same bitcoin to Bob.

By the rules, the network accepts only one of the transactions. This is called a race attacksince there is a race which transaction will be accepted first.

Alice can reduce the risk of race attack stipulating that she will not deliver the goods until Eve's payment to Alice appears in the blockchain. A variant race attack which has been called a Finney attack by reference bitcoin output volume Hal Finney requires the participation of a miner. Instead of bitcoin output volume both payment requests to pay Bob and Alice with the same coins to the network, Eve issues only Alice's payment request to the network, while the accomplice tries to mine a block that includes the payment to Bob instead of Alice.

There is a positive probability that the rogue miner will succeed before the network, in which case the payment to Alice will be rejected. As with the plain race attack, Alice can reduce the risk of a Finney attack by waiting for the payment to be included in the blockchain.

Each block that is added to the blockchain, starting with the block containing a given transaction, is called a confirmation of that transaction. Ideally, merchants and services that receive payment in bitcoin should wait for at least one confirmation to be distributed over the network, before assuming that the payment was done.

Deanonymisation is a strategy in data mining in which anonymous data is cross-referenced with other bitcoin output volume of data to re-identify the anonymous data source. Along with transaction graph analysis, which may reveal connections between bitcoin addresses pseudonyms[14] [19] there is a possible attack [20] which links a user's pseudonym bitcoin output volume its IP address. Bitcoin output volume the peer is using Torthe attack includes a method to separate the peer from the Tor network, forcing them to use their real IP address for any further transactions.

The attack makes use bitcoin output volume bitcoin mechanisms of relaying peer addresses and anti- DoS protection. Each miner can choose which transactions bitcoin output volume included in or exempted from a block. Upon receiving a new transaction a node must validate it: To carry out that check the node needs to access the blockchain. Any user who bitcoin output volume not trust his network neighbors, should keep a full local copy of the blockchain, so that any input can be verified.

As noted in Nakamoto's whitepaper, it is possible to verify bitcoin payments without running bitcoin output volume full network bitcoin output volume simplified payment verification, SPV. A user only needs a copy of the block headers of the longest chain, which are available by querying network nodes until it is apparent that the longest chain has been bitcoin output volume. Then, get the Merkle branch linking the transaction to its block.

Linking the transaction to a place in the chain demonstrates that a network node has accepted bitcoin output volume, and blocks added after it further establish the confirmation. While it is possible to store any digital file in the blockchain, the bitcoin output volume the transaction bitcoin output volume, the larger any associated fees become. Various items have been embedded, including URLs to child pornography, an ASCII art image of Ben Bernankematerial from the Wikileaks cablesprayers from bitcoin miners, and the original bitcoin whitepaper.

The use of bitcoin by criminals has attracted the attention of financial regulators, legislative bodies, law enforcement, and the media.

Senate held a hearing on virtual currencies in November Several news outlets have asserted that bitcoin output volume popularity of bitcoins hinges on the ability to use them to purchase illegal goods. A CMU researcher estimated that in4. Due to the anonymous nature and the lack of central control on these markets, it is hard to know whether the services are real or just trying bitcoin output volume take the bitcoins. Several deep web black markets have been shut by authorities.

In October Silk Road was shut down by U. Some black market sites may seek to steal bitcoins from customers. The bitcoin community branded bitcoin output volume site, Sheep Marketplace, as a scam when it prevented withdrawals and shut down after an alleged bitcoins theft. According to the Internet Watch Foundationa UK-based charity, bitcoin is used to purchase child pornography, and almost such websites accept it as payment. Bitcoin isn't the sole way to purchase child pornography online, as Troels Oertling, head of the cybercrime unit at Europolstates, " Ukash and paysafecard Bitcoins may not be ideal for money laundering, because all transactions are public.

In earlyan operator of a U. A report by UK's Treasury and Home Office named "UK national risk assessment of money laundering and terrorist financing" October found that, of the twelve methods examined in the report, bitcoin carries the lowest risk of being bitcoin output volume for money laundering, with the most common money laundering method being the banks.

Securities and Exchange Commission charged the company and its founder in "with defrauding investors in a Ponzi scheme involving bitcoin". From Wikipedia, the free encyclopedia. For a broader coverage of this topic, see Bitcoin.

Trade by barter meaning

  • Utoken vs bitcoin minerals

    Exhaust gas to liquid heat exchangers

  • Bitcoin rate in inr live

    Blockchain uk bank deposits disabled ipad

How to get ethereum life staff

  • Printer bot lego mindstorms nxt 2.0 programming software download

    Ltcusdbitcoin exchange ethereum exchange

  • Bitcoin xt adoption rate of new technologies

    How to get money in bitcoin wallet

  • Sierra tools liquid transfer pump

    Bitcoin billionaire apk mod 201 apk download

Electrum review bitcoin robot

48 comments Buy and sell bitcoin in pakistan karachi

Ripple price surges 20% ethereum nears $500 as cryptorally spreads

In a centralized economy, currency is issued by a central bank at a rate that is supposed to match the growth of the amount of goods that are exchanged so that these goods can be traded with stable prices. The monetary base is controlled by a central bank. In the United States, the Fed increases the monetary base by issuing currency, increasing the amount banks have on reserve or by a process called Quantitative Easing. In a fully decentralized monetary system, there is no central authority that regulates the monetary base.

Instead, currency is created by the nodes of a peer-to-peer network. The Bitcoin generation algorithm defines, in advance, how currency will be created and at what rate. Any currency that is generated by a malicious user that does not follow the rules will be rejected by the network and thus is worthless. Bitcoins are created each time a user discovers a new block.

The rate of block creation is adjusted every blocks to aim for a constant two week adjustment period equivalent to 6 per hour. The result is that the number of bitcoins in existence will not exceed slightly less than 21 million. Satoshi has never really justified or explained many of these constants.

This decreasing-supply algorithm was chosen because it approximates the rate at which commodities like gold are mined. Users who use their computers to perform calculations to try and discover a block are thus called Miners.

This chart shows the number of bitcoins that will exist in the near future. The Year is a forecast and may be slightly off. This is one of two only known reductions in the total mined supply of Bitcoin. Therefore, from block onwards, all total supply estimates must technically be reduced by 1 Satoshi. Because the number of bitcoins created each time a user discovers a new block - the block reward - is halved based on a fixed interval of blocks, and the time it takes on average to discover a block can vary based on mining power and the network difficulty , the exact time when the block reward is halved can vary as well.

Consequently, the time the last Bitcoin will be created will also vary, and is subject to speculation based on assumptions. If the mining power had remained constant since the first Bitcoin was mined, the last Bitcoin would have been mined somewhere near October 8th, Due to the mining power having increased overall over time, as of block , - assuming mining power remained constant from that block forward - the last Bitcoin will be mined on May 7th, As it is very difficult to predict how mining power will evolve into the future - i.

The total number of bitcoins, as mentioned earlier, has an asymptote at 21 million, due to a side-effect of the data structure of the blockchain - specifically the integer storage type of the transaction output , this exact value would have been 20,, Should this technical limitation be adjusted by increasing the size of the field, the total number will still only approach a maximum of 21 million. The number of bitcoins are presented in a floating point format.

However, these values are based on the number of satoshi per block originally in integer format to prevent compounding error. Therefore, all calculations from this block onwards must now, to be accurate, include this underpay in total Bitcoins in existence. Then, in an act of sheer stupidity, a more recent miner who failed to implement RSK properly destroyed an entire block reward of The bitcoin inflation rate steadily trends downwards. The block reward given to miners is made up of newly-created bitcoins plus transaction fees.

As inflation goes to zero miners will obtain an income only from transaction fees which will provide an incentive to keep mining to make transactions irreversible. Due to deep technical reasons, block space is a scarce commodity , getting a transaction mined can be seen as purchasing a portion of it. By analogy, on average every 10 minutes a fixed amount of land is created and no more, people wanting to make transactions bid for parcels of this land.

The sale of this land is what supports the miners even in a zero-inflation regime. The price of this land is set by demand for transactions because the supply is fixed and known and the mining difficulty readjusts around this to keep the average interval at 10 minutes.

The theoretical total number of bitcoins, slightly less than 21 million, should not be confused with the total spendable supply. The total spendable supply is always lower than the theoretical total supply, and is subject to accidental loss, willful destruction, and technical peculiarities. One way to see a part of the destruction of coin is by collecting a sum of all unspent transaction outputs, using a Bitcoin RPC command gettxoutsetinfo.

Note however that this does not take into account outputs that are exceedingly unlikely to be spent as is the case in loss and destruction via constructed addresses, for example. The algorithm which decides whether a block is valid only checks to verify whether the total amount of the reward exceeds the reward plus available fees. Therefore it is possible for a miner to deliberately choose to underpay himself by any value: This is a form of underpay which the reference implementation recognises as impossible to spend.

Some of the other types below are not recognised as officially destroying Bitcoins; it is possible for example to spend the 1BitcoinEaterAddressDontSendf59kuE if a corresponding private key is used although this would imply that Bitcoin has been broken. Bitcoins may be lost if the conditions required to spend them are no longer known.

For example, if you made a transaction to an address that requires a private key in order to spend those bitcoins further, had written that private key down on a piece of paper, but that piece of paper was lost. In this case, that bitcoin may also be considered lost, as the odds of randomly finding a matching private key are such that it is generally considered impossible. Bitcoins may also be willfully 'destroyed' - for example by attaching conditions that make it impossible to spend them.

A common method is to send bitcoin to an address that was constructed and only made to pass validity checks, but for which no private key is actually known. An example of such an address is "1BitcoinEaterAddressDontSendf59kuE", where the last "f59kuE" is text to make the preceding constructed text pass validation.

Finding a matching private key is, again, generally considered impossible. For an example of how difficult this would be, see Vanitygen. Another common method is to send bitcoin in a transaction where the conditions for spending are not just unfathomably unlikely, but literally impossible to meet. A lesser known method is to send bitcoin to an address based on private key that is outside the range of valid ECDSA private keys.

The first BTC 50, included in the genesis block , cannot be spent as its transaction is not in the global database. In older versions of the bitcoin reference code, a miner could make their coinbase transaction block reward have the exact same ID as used in a previous block [3]. This effectively caused the previous block reward to become unspendable. Two known such cases [4] [5] are left as special cases in the code [6] as part of BIP changes that fixed this issue.

These transactions were BTC 50 each. While the number of bitcoins in existence will never exceed slightly less than 21 million, the money supply of bitcoins can exceed 21 million due to Fractional-reserve banking.

Because the monetary base of bitcoins cannot be expanded, the currency would be subject to severe deflation if it becomes widely used. Keynesian economists argue that deflation is bad for an economy because it incentivises individuals and businesses to save money rather than invest in businesses and create jobs.

The Austrian school of thought counters this criticism, claiming that as deflation occurs in all stages of production, entrepreneurs who invest benefit from it. As a result, profit ratios tend to stay the same and only their magnitudes change.

In other words, in a deflationary environment, goods and services decrease in price, but at the same time the cost for the production of these goods and services tend to decrease proportionally, effectively not affecting profits.

Price deflation encourages an increase in hoarding — hence savings — which in turn tends to lower interest rates and increase the incentive for entrepreneurs to invest in projects of longer term. A fixed money supply, or a supply altered only in accord with objective and calculable criteria, is a necessary condition to a meaningful just price of money.

Retrieved from " https: Navigation menu Personal tools Create account Log in. Views Read View source View history. Sister projects Essays Source. This page was last edited on 13 June , at Content is available under Creative Commons Attribution 3. Privacy policy About Bitcoin Wiki Disclaimers.